Marie V. Pitcher
April 4, 1937 – April 5, 2021
Passed peacefully away at St. Patrick’s Mercy Nursing Home surrounded by her loving family, Marie Pitcher of St. John’s, formerly of Hopeall, in her 84th year.
Predeceased by her parents, Albert and Clara Pitcher; sister, Marjorie March; brother, Roy Pitcher; and brother-in-law, Albert Cranford.
Leaving to mourn with fond and loving memories are her brothers, Nelson Pitcher and Elwood Pitcher; sisters, Joyce Cranford, Florence (John) Pike, and Phyllis (Stewart) Legge; sister-in-law, Mildred Pitcher; special friends, Anne Benson and Muriel Hopkins; as well as many nephews, nieces, extended family members, and friends.
Marie worked with health care for 37 years. She began working at the old General Hospital and then at the Health Sciences Centre until her retirement.
